The Place
Situated amidst the picturesque landscapes of the Scottish Highlands, Royal Golf Hotel is a haven of elegance and luxury. Overlooking the renowned Royal Dornoch Golf Course and the stunning Dornoch Firth, our hotel offers guests a unique blend of traditional charm, modern amenities, and unparalleled hospitality. With its rich history dating back to the 19th century, Royal Golf Hotel is a cherished landmark in the heart of Dornoch, attracting discerning travellers from around the world seeking a memorable Scottish getaway.
The Position
We are currently seeking a dedicated and hardworking individual to join our team as a Kitchen Porter on a seasonal basis. Reporting directly to the Head Chef, the Kitchen Porter will play a crucial role in supporting the smooth and efficient operation of our kitchen. From washing dishes and cleaning equipment to assisting with food preparation, the Kitchen Porter is an integral part of our culinary team.
